Today I will tell you about one of my favorite journalistic websites, this is CIPER (ciperchile.cl).

The Center for Investigative Journalism was born in 2007 in response to the need to use the internet for the dissemination of news that is not always thoroughly investigated by traditional media. That is why CIPER is one of the best alternatives medium in Chile.


The journalist Mónica González is the director of CIPER

As for its editorial line, CIPER is a means that publishes without limitations, which is why it has uncovered several controversial cases as an adulteration in Carabineros in 2011, which ended with the resignation of its then General Director , The irregularities of Sergio Jadue in the ANFP or the alliance with Wikileaks in the uncovering of diplomatic cables. The above makes it possible to deduce that CIPER is a medium that usually sets standards.
I visit Ciper every week, especially when he sets the tone for the media through his highlights.


As for its financing, CIPER has received contributions from COPESA, a media company of La Tercera, which does not seem affected by the content of its publications.

Rap is a musical genre that was born in the United States, and has been developed in many different countries in Latin America, and Chile is no exception.

Within the Chilean rap, the exponent that I like is Portavoz, because I feel that he has achieved a great way his musical career, even when the mainstream media do not take this kind of music into account. Besides I like it because it comes from the same commune as I, Conchalí.

With regard to his musical work Portavoz has released two albums: Formato de MC in 2005 and Escribo Rap con R de Revolución in 2012. The latter allowed him to acquire more knowledge on the part of the Chilean and Latin American public.

Cover of Escribo Rap con R de Revolución (2012)


The letters of Portavoz are characterized by a high content of protest, in which the historical demands of the Chilean people are portrayed health or dignified education. El Otro Chile is one of the most emblematic.

Parallel to his work as a soloist, Portavoz has a group called Salvaje Decibel, in which social demands are also key in their lyrics.

Currently, Portavoz is making his first tour in Europe, and is also preparing what will be his third album

In this photo they are appreciated eight of the members of the Chilean soccer team, who are encouraged to run after Alexis Sánchez converted the penalty with which Chile won the first Copa America in its history.

     Photo by Rodrigo Sáenz

 The photo becomes even more special when it is perceived it looks
 that the memorial of the National Stadium made in dedication to the political prisoners that housed the sports coliseum during the first months of the military dictatorship of Augusto Pinochet. This memorial says: “a town without memory is a town without future”.

The photo was taken by Rodrigo Sáenz, a graphic reporter for Agencia Uno, who was in charge of capturing that magical moment of the cold night of July 4, 2015.
